    The Cost of Self Storage in Detroit, MI

    Detroit, Michigan, offers a unique landscape for storage unit costs influenced by several key factors. The city’s revitalization in recent years has spurred demand for both residential and commercial storage. Detroit’s cost of living is lower than the national average, which can make storage units more affordable. However, fluctuations in real estate prices, especially in areas undergoing gentrification, may contribute to variations in storage costs.

    Detroit has several colleges and universities, including Wayne State University and the University of Detroit Mercy. This student population drives seasonal demand for storage, particularly during summer and semester breaks, which could temporarily raise rates. The number of storage facilities available in Detroit also plays a role — facilities in more densely populated neighborhoods may experience higher demand, pushing prices up, while those farther from the city center may offer more budget-friendly options.

    Average price of storage units by size in Detroit, MI

    Size of Storage Unit City Average State Average National Average
    5×5 $$128 $40 $43
    5×10 NA $56 $60
    10×10 $158 $89 $94
    10×15 $152 $108 $117
    10×20 NA $119 $132

    What to Consider When Looking for Storage in Detroit, MI

    When selecting a storage unit in Detroit, it’s essential to consider factors beyond size — particularly security and climate control. Detroit’s property crime rate is high, nearly double the national average of 35.4. This elevated rate underscores the importance of choosing a storage facility with robust security measures, such as 24/7 surveillance, gated access, and on-site personnel, to safeguard your belongings.

    Detroit experiences a humid continental climate, with hot summers and cold winters. The average high in July is 83°F, while January sees average lows around 21°F. These temperature fluctuations and humidity variations can affect sensitive items like electronics, wooden furniture, and documents. Opting for a climate-controlled storage unit helps maintain a consistent environment, protecting your possessions from potential damage due to extreme temperatures and humidity.

    Helpful Tips for Moving to Detroit, MI

    Detroit, Michigan, is rich in history and culture and offers various attractions and amenities. Known as the Motor City, it’s home to the Detroit Institute of Arts and the Motown Museum, which celebrate the city’s musical heritage. The revitalized Detroit Riverfront provides scenic views and recreational opportunities, while Belle Isle Park offers a natural retreat with its aquarium and conservatory. Sports enthusiasts can enjoy games from teams like the Detroit Lions and Detroit Tigers, and the city’s vibrant food scene features unique offerings such as Detroit-style pizza.

    For those seeking affordable living options, Detroit has neighborhoods that cater to various budgets. Areas like Jefferson-Chalmers and Grandmont-Rosedale offer relatively affordable housing with a mix of historic charm and suburban tranquility. The city’s public transit options connect key areas, including the QLine streetcar and the SMART bus system. However, many residents rely on cars due to the sprawling nature of the metro area. Commuters often find that the city’s ongoing development creates affordable living opportunities while still enjoying its rich cultural and social scene.

    Frequently Asked Questions

    How much is a storage unit in Detroit, MI?

    The cost of your Detroit, MI storage unit will vary depending on its size, location, amenities, and other factors. For example, the average cost of a 5′ x 5′ unit is $128 a month, while a larger, 10′ x 15′ space averages $152 a month. Cost may also vary depending on the season, with prices increasing during high demand.

    How to get cheap storage units in Detroit, MI?

    To find cheap storage units in Detroit, MI, compare prices online. Look for facilities in less busy areas, since units farther from downtown or college campuses may be more affordable. Check for promotions like first-month-free deals or discounts for long-term rentals. Consider the unit size and avoid paying for extra space if unnecessary. Book in advance during low-demand seasons to secure the best rates and options if possible.

    Is climate-controlled self-storage necessary in Detroit, MI?

    In Detroit’s humid continental climate, with hot summers and cold winters, climate-controlled storage is advisable for sensitive items like electronics, wood furniture, and documents. These units maintain consistent temperature and humidity levels, protecting belongings from damage due to extreme weather conditions. While not mandatory for all items, investing in climate-controlled storage offers peace of mind, especially for valuables susceptible to temperature and moisture fluctuations.

    What size storage unit do I need?

    The appropriate storage unit size depends on the volume and type of items you plan to store. For example, a 5’x 5′ unit is suitable for small items or a few boxes, while a 10 ‘x 10′ unit can accommodate the contents of a one-bedroom apartment. Larger units, like 10′ x 20’, are ideal for storing the contents of a multi-bedroom house. Assess your belongings and consider future storage needs to select the right unit size.

    Does my renter’s insurance cover storage units?

    Yes, most renters insurance policies extend coverage to items stored off-site in a Detroit, MI self storage unit. However, this coverage is typically limited to a percentage of your policy’s total value, often around 10 percent. For instance, with a $30,000 policy, you may have coverage of up to $3,000 for stored belongings. Given these limitations, especially for high-value items, you may want to consider additional self-storage insurance to ensure adequate protection.
